Full Stack Developer Education: Essential Skills, Courses & Career Pathways

by | May 24, 2025 | Blog


Full Stack⁢ Developer Education: Essential Skills, Courses &‍ Career Pathways for EdTech Jobs


Full Stack Developer ​Education: Essential Skills, ‌Courses & Career Pathways for EdTech Jobs

In today’s rapidly evolving educational landscape, institutions like universities, colleges, and schools increasingly rely on ⁤technology to deliver engaging, effective learning experiences. If you’re considering a job ​as a full ​stack developer in education​ technology (EdTech),you’re entering a field bursting with opportunity,purpose,and innovation. This article will guide ‌you through the core skills,recommended courses,and career pathways to jumpstart or advance your journey as an EdTech full stack developer,while sharing​ practical tips and key benefits of working ‌in this rewarding sector.

Why Full Stack Developers Are Vital in ‌EdTech

As universities, schools, and colleges digitally transform their teaching, administration, and student engagement, full stack developers serve as the backbone of this tech revolution. Whether it’s building online learning platforms, developing administrative dashboards, or ⁢integrating new educational tools, full stack developers play a pivotal role by handling both front-end ⁢and back-end programming—and everything in between. This versatility makes full stack developer ⁢education roles highly sought-after and essential in the modern educational ecosystem.

essential Skills for a Full stack Developer in Education Technology

to thrive in an EdTech full stack developer career,⁢ you’ll need⁤ a⁤ blend of technical expertise, soft skills, and a passion for improving education. Here’s what sets⁣ top candidates apart:

Technical Skills

  • Programming ⁢Languages: Proficiency in languages such as JavaScript ‍(Node.js), Python, Ruby, Java, or PHP is crucial.
  • Front-End‍ Frameworks: Experience with ⁣ React.js, ⁢Angular, Vue.js, or similar tools to craft ‍intuitive user interfaces.
  • Back-End Growth: Mastery of frameworks like Express.js, Django, Ruby on Rails, Spring ⁣Boot, or Laravel.
  • Database Management: Working knowledge⁤ of⁢ relational and⁣ NoSQL databases (e.g.,MySQL,PostgreSQL,MongoDB).
  • API Design & integration: Strong grasp of RESTful APIs, GraphQL, and systems integration to connect⁢ features and services.
  • Version Control: Proficiency with tools like Git and familiar workflows (GitHub, GitLab).
  • DevOps⁢ &⁢ Deployment: Skills in CI/CD, cloud services (AWS, Azure, Google Cloud), Docker, and Kubernetes are increasingly valuable.
  • Security⁤ Practices: Familiarity with data privacy, ⁤secure coding principles, and regulatory standards (e.g., FERPA, GDPR).

Soft & Domain-specific Skills

  • Problem-Solving: Ability to troubleshoot and optimize EdTech solutions based on real-world feedback.
  • Collaboration: Comfort working alongside educators, administrators, and cross-functional teams.
  • UX/UI Sensitivity: Awareness of accessibility, user experience, ⁢and the educational needs of diverse learners.
  • Continuous learning: Enthusiasm for new technologies, teaching methods, and EdTech tools.
  • Project ⁢Management: Agile methodologies, time⁢ management, and effective communication skills.

Top ⁤Courses and Certifications for edtech Full Stack Developers

Formal education isn’t always required to become a full stack developer in education technology, but relevant‌ courses and certifications can​ sharpen your skills and set you apart. Consider the following learning pathways:

Degree Programs

  • Bachelor’s in Computer Science, Software Engineering, or Information systems – A solid foundation for entry-level roles.
  • Master’s in Educational Technology ​– Combines technical skills​ with insights into pedagogy‍ and digital learning environments.

online courses & Bootcamps

  • Full Stack Web ⁣Development Bootcamps – Comprehensive programs covering HTML/CSS, JavaScript, databases, APIs, and project-based learning.
  • MOOCs (Massive Open⁤ Online Courses): Popular platforms offer full stack developer tracks and EdTech-specific ​modules.
  • Specialized EdTech Courses – Courses on learning management systems (LMS), educational app development, or integrating technology into classrooms.

Relevant Certifications

  • Certified‌ Full Stack Web Developer
  • Google IT Support Professional Certificate
  • Microsoft Certified: Azure Developer Associate
  • AWS Certified Developer
  • ISTE​ Certification for Educators/Developers ‍–‍ Demonstrates EdTech-specific competencies.

key Responsibilities of Full Stack Developers in Universities, Colleges, and‌ Schools

Job descriptions can vary, but⁢ roles in education technology often include:

  • Designing and maintaining e-learning platforms, portals, and websites.
  • Developing and integrating administrative dashboards for students and faculty.
  • Ensuring mobile, ‍accessible, and user-pleasant educational applications.
  • Migrating conventional classroom resources and assessments to digital formats.
  • Collaborating with teachers, administrators, ⁢and‌ instructional designers on product development.
  • Implementing security and privacy protocols to protect sensitive educational data.
  • Providing technical support and continuous improvement‌ for EdTech tools.

Career Pathways for EdTech Full stack Developers

Landing a‍ job as‍ a full stack⁣ developer in the education sector ​opens doors to a dynamic career with upward mobility​ and meaningful ​impact.Some typical pathways include:

  • Entry-Level Developer: Junior or associate roles supporting EdTech projects at universities, colleges, or school districts.
  • Mid-Level Full Stack Developer: Self-reliant responsibility on cross-platform application‍ development and integration projects.
  • Senior Developer / Team Lead: Leading teams, architecting solutions, and mentoring junior developers in EdTech organizations.
  • product Manager / Technical Lead: Transitioning into project⁢ management, UI/UX strategy, or ​digital conversion leadership.
  • EdTech Startup Founder or CTO: leveraging experience to‌ launch or lead innovative educational technology startups.

In addition, you can specialize in ⁣fields like:

  • eLearning Development (e.g., SCORM-compliant platforms)
  • Data Analytics for Education
  • AI-Driven Learning Tools
  • Mobile Educational App Development
  • Cloud-Based Learning ⁢Infrastructure

Benefits of Working as a Full stack Developer in Education Technology

Choosing a full stack developer job in education offers unique rewards, including:

  • Purposeful impact: Your work directly‌ supports teachers, learners, and educational access⁤ worldwide.
  • Job Stability: Educational institutions prioritize long-term tech investments, making jobs secure and fulfilling.
  • Growth Opportunities: As EdTech evolves,new roles and specialties ⁢constantly emerge.
  • Continuous Learning: Exposure to the latest innovations in teaching, assessment, and digital pedagogy.
  • Collaborative Surroundings: Work with passionate educators,researchers,and technologists.
  • Flexible⁣ Working⁤ Arrangements: ‌ Many universities and EdTech organizations ​offer remote or hybrid work options.

Practical tips for Landing an EdTech Full Stack Developer Job

Ready to kick-start your ​EdTech career? Try these actionable strategies to make yourself a standout candidate:

  • Build a Strong Portfolio: Develop case studies, open-source contributions, or sample e-learning projects emphasizing your technical ⁣and educational focus.
  • Network in EdTech Communities: Attend conferences, webinars, or online forums dedicated‍ to education technology.
  • Stay Updated with Trends: Follow leading EdTech publications, podcasts, and research to stay ahead.
  • Customize Your Resume: Highlight experience with learning platforms (LMS), education apps, or any school/university-based projects.
  • Demonstrate Soft Skills: Emphasize teamwork, communication, and user empathy—critical‍ in education​ settings.
  • Consider internships or Volunteer Projects: Gain hands-on experience at schools,​ universities, or EdTech startups.
  • Learn Compliance Standards: Familiarize yourself with FERPA, GDPR, ⁤and digital accessibility requirements for educational software.

Conclusion: Your Future as ⁤a Full Stack Developer​ in EdTech

The demand for skilled full stack developers in education technology continues to surge as digital transformation reshapes universities,‌ colleges, and schools worldwide. By developing core programming skills, pursuing⁤ relevant courses, and understanding the unique needs of the education sector, you’ll be well positioned to land rewarding jobs, drive innovation, and make a meaningful difference in teaching and learning.Whether you’re just starting out or seeking your ‌next big challenge, a future in EdTech promises​ professional growth, job stability, and the chance to empower educators ⁢and students ⁣through technology.